The charm of simplistic plant holders

Modern simplicity remains a perennial trend in home décor, and this extends to your outdoor areas too. Plant containers that exude a minimalist appeal with clean lines, understated colours, and straightforward design frequently top the trend charts.

Terra cotta pots from The HC Companies blend seamlessly into various outdoor aesthetics, offering both style and function. Their porous nature allows the roots of your plants to breathe, promoting healthier growth.

The Sky's the Limit with Hanging Planters

For those with limited outdoor space, hanging planters are a boon. They allow you to display a plethora of plants in a vertical arrangement, creating an enchanting green cascade.

Macrame plant hangers from Pöppelmann inject your outdoor space with a trendy boho-chic vibe while optimising the space available. Pair them with trailing plants like ivy or string of pearls for an impressive effect.

Statement Planters: Embrace Grandeur

Sometimes, your patio may call for an element of grandeur. Large, statement planters are just what you need. Housing larger plants like palm trees or ferns, these planters are typically made from durable materials like stone or fiberglass and can transform your patio into an opulent green haven.

Take It Higher with Elevated Planters

Raised planters or trough planters are a functional solution that also adds to the aesthetic charm of your outdoor space. They provide excellent drainage, deter pests, and can be easily moved to follow the sun or retreat into the shade, making them a versatile choice for your patio.

Unveiling Smart Pots: Automation Meets Horticulture: Central to the technological advancements within the pots and planters market is the introduction of intelligent or 'smart' pots. These containers are more than your average plant holders; they are furnished with sensors and automatic irrigation systems, capable of discerning when your flora requires hydration. This innovation eradicates guesswork from plant nurturing and promotes the creation of ideal growing conditions. Certain models go a step further by adjusting the soil's pH level and nutrient content, crafting an environment bespoke to each type of plant.

IoT in Gardening: Connectivity is the New Green: The Internet of Things (IoT) has opened new avenues for tech-savvy gardeners. Smart pots and planters can now be connected to smartphones or home automation systems, providing real-time data on the plants’ health. Users receive updates and reminders for watering schedules, sunlight exposure, and even impending weather conditions that may affect their plants. This not only eases plant care but also empowers people to cultivate a green thumb.
